BusinessObjects DataIntegrator核心教程

需积分: 9 2 下载量 98 浏览量 更新于2024-09-21 收藏 2.32MB PDF 举报
"BO DATA 核心教程" "BO DATA 核心教程" 是一份详细讲解BusinessObjects DataIntegrator (简称DI) 的核心技术手册。DataIntegrator是BusinessObjects公司(现为SAP的一部分)的一款强大的数据集成工具,它用于在各种数据源之间进行数据提取、转换和加载(ETL)操作,帮助用户构建高质量的数据仓库和数据整合解决方案。 1. **DataIntegrator的核心功能** DataIntegrator的主要用途是处理和集成来自不同来源的数据,包括数据库、文件系统、Web服务等。它提供了一整套工具,让用户可以设计、测试和部署复杂的ETL流程,实现数据清洗、转换、验证和加载。 2. **DataIntegrator组件** - **Designer**: 这是DataIntegrator的主要设计环境,用户可以在这里创建、编辑和管理各种对象,如数据流、工作流、映射、转换等。 - **Repository**: 数据库存储库,用于保存所有的元数据和设计信息。 - **Server**: 执行ETL任务的引擎,它可以是单服务器或多服务器配置,以支持高可用性和可扩展性。 3. **DataIntegrator的系统配置** - **Windows实施**: 提供了在Windows操作系统上的安装和运行指南,包括所需的软件和硬件配置。 - **UNIX实施**: 对于UNIX环境,教程也提供了相应的系统要求和部署步骤。 4. **DataIntegratorDesigner窗口** 设计师窗口是用户与DataIntegrator交互的主要界面,它包含各种面板和视图,如元数据浏览器、工作区、控制台等,用于创建和管理对象,以及调试和监控数据流。 5. **DataIntegrator对象** - **对象层次结构**: 在DataIntegrator中,对象按照特定的层次结构组织,如项目、包、工作流、数据流、映射等。这些对象代表了ETL流程的不同部分,用户可以在这个结构中定义数据源、转换规则和目标位置。 6. **教程结构和前提条件** 教程旨在引导读者逐步学习DataIntegrator的基本概念和操作,包括如何设置开发环境、创建资源库、源和目标数据库,以及安装和运行教程所需的SQL脚本。这为初学者提供了实践操作的机会,以便他们能够快速掌握DataIntegrator的核心技能。 7. **版权和第三方提供商** 文档中还提到了BusinessObjects的相关专利和商标信息,并指出DataIntegrator可能包含第三方软件的组件,可能需要遵循额外的许可条款。 "BO DATA 核心教程" 是一个全面的学习资源,适合那些想要深入理解和使用BusinessObjects DataIntegrator的IT专业人士。通过这个教程,读者将能够了解DataIntegrator的工作原理,学习如何利用它来构建高效的数据集成解决方案。